On May 21, 2019, the IRS issued Rev. Proc. 2019-25 announcing the annual inflation-adjusted health savings account and related contribution limits for calendar year 2020.

HSA Limits

Self-Only Coverage

Family Coverage

Annual contribution limit

2018: $3,450
2019: $3,500
2020: $3,550

2018: $6,900
2019: $7,000
2020: $7,100

Catch-up contribution (age 55 and older)

$1,000
(2018-2020)

HDHP minimum deductible requirements

2018: $1,350
2019: $1,350
2020: $1,400

2018: $2,700
2019: $2,700
2020: $2,800

HDHP out-of-pocket maximum

2018: $6,650
2019: $6,750
2020: $6,900

2018: $13,300
2019: $13,500
2020: $13,800
